    1. Under normal circumstances, a new pair of jeans will shrink by about 3%-7% after the first cleaning. If you want a pair of jeans that fit perfectly, estimate the size of the jeans after washing when choosing them to avoid excessive shrinkage and make the jeans unfit.

    2. If you like to wash jeans by hand, you can choose a normal size for your waist when choosing jeans, and the length of the pants should be one size larger than the normal length. When you wash them for the first time, let them soak in warm water for 30 minutes, and when they are dry, the length of the jeans will shrink to the length that suits you.

    There may be two reasons why pants are shrinking:

    1. It may be washed with hot water. Try to wash it with cool water, hot water will shrink the pants, and the hotter the shrinkage, the more serious the shrinkage.

    2. If there is shrinkage just by washing it with cold water, it means that there is a problem with the quality of the pants themselves.

    Solution: For the problem of cause 1, you can try to wash it and use a steam iron to iron it while pulling it when it is 8 dry, so that you can basically return your pants to their original length, or you can take it to the dry cleaner and ask the clerk to use steam ironing to pull hard, pay attention to the air pressure to be large. In this way, the effect of the trouser material is better, and it should be pulled appropriately, not on one side and small on the other.

    For the quality of the pants, you can only negotiate with the store to return and exchange the goods.

    Washed jeans do not shrink, and primary color jeans shrink. A pair of jeans in a natural color that has not been processed in the water will be made easier for workers to cut by applying a layer of pulp to dry and harden the pants after they have been dyed. Therefore, after buying the primary color jeans that have not been in the water, you need to go through the water to make the fabric soft, and remove the pulp by the way.

    Most raw cattle have not been shrunk prevented, so they will shrink.

    The washing buffalo has completed this process in the factory, and has increased the washing effect with technical means, so the washed jeans will not shrink after entering the water, and they can be worn directly after buying.
